Skip to content

Commit

Permalink
Update pattern_matching.md (#2976)
Browse files Browse the repository at this point in the history
There's a typo in line 59 that makes the sentence meaningless.

The correct translation of the sentence "When we pin a variable *we* match on the existing value rather than rebinding to a new one."

...is the one suggested in the commit:
"Quando fixamos uma variável, *nós* a associamos ao valor existente ao invés de reassociar a um novo valor."
  • Loading branch information
thiagonebuloni committed Jan 14, 2024
1 parent 3a6e30e commit 700fb48
Showing 1 changed file with 1 addition and 1 deletion.
2 changes: 1 addition & 1 deletion lessons/pt/basics/pattern_matching.md
Original file line number Diff line number Diff line change
Expand Up @@ -56,7 +56,7 @@ iex> {:ok, value} = {:error}

Acabamos de aprender que o operador match manuseia atribuições quando o lado esquerdo da associação é uma variável. Em alguns casos este comportamento de reassociação de variável é algo não desejável. Para estas situações, nós temos o operador pin:`^`.

Quando fixamos a variável em associação ao valor existente ao invés de reassociar a um novo valor. Vamos ver como isso funciona:
Quando fixamos uma variável, nós a associamos ao valor existente ao invés de reassociar a um novo valor. Vamos ver como isso funciona:

```elixir
iex> x = 1
Expand Down

0 comments on commit 700fb48

Please sign in to comment.